can someone help me figure out what is wrong?

I was driving the ABS light and Battery light came on then the radio shut off. I rolled up passenger side window but driver side would not roll up. Got home and the window rolled up. Next day battery was dead. What are the next step to diagnose the issue? Thanks!

What was happening w/ the volt meter? Alternator, battery and voltage regulator are the most likely culprits.

thanks for your help, here is the latest...

My Battery is fairly new maybe five months old. I have a battery charger and charged the battery up. The car started but the voltage began to plummit after a couple minutes I am pretty sure it is an alternator issue. How hard is this to replace? I am pretty handy and dont want to go to the dealership and pay the quoted $1000 for a new one. Thanks again for all of your help. 2001 c2 seal grey/black.

Alternator is not too hard to do if you are a little handy. Look online (google search by the part number) for sources other than a dealer. The OEM price is over $1,500. What year is your car, I can look up the part number.
